Great to meet you!

It is my privilege and my pleasure to assist individuals in addressing and resolving the effects of overwhelming experience in their lives. I provide assistance with anxiety and depression and in regard to a wide range of difficult experiences from more commonplace life experiences to severely traumatic life events.

As a Licensed Clinical Social Worker I have worked extensively with children, adolescents, and adults (including senior adults) within both the mental health and addiction fields. I have worked with significant numbers of individuals in the arts and from within LGBTQ communities and communities of color, as well as with military veterans, law enforcement officers, and first responders.

I am a graduate of the National Institute for the Psychotherapies' postgraduate Trauma Certification Program and possess the Telemental Health Training Certificate (THTC) issued by Ray Barrett's Telehealth Certification Institute.

My approach to therapy

As well as being well versed in regard to traditional (or mainstream) psychotherapy, I have an enormous appreciation for alternative and complementary approaches to mental health care and possess training and experience in multiple modalities including EMDR (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ing), SE (Somatic Experiencing), NLP (Neuro-Linguistic Programming), Ericksonian Hypnosis, IFS (Internal Family Systems) and Brainspotting.

What you can expect from me

A warm welcome and genuine interest in getting to know you and in becoming familiar with your particular situations, needs, goals, and dreams - in your own ways and at your own pace. I enjoy working collaboratively and am hugely optimistic in regard to the abilities that all of us have to learn and to grow.
